Assessment And Determination Of The Dynamics Of Changes In Salinization Of Irrigated Lands Under The Influence Of Climate Change (In The Case Of Syrdarya Province), Sarvar Akramovich Odilov, Sayidjahon Zokir Ogli Hasanov, Rashid Anarovich Kulmatov, Jasur Ashiralievich Mirzaev Mar 2021

Assessment And Determination Of The Dynamics Of Changes In Salinization Of Irrigated Lands Under The Influence Of Climate Change (In The Case Of Syrdarya Province), Sarvar Akramovich Odilov, Sayidjahon Zokir Ogli Hasanov, Rashid Anarovich Kulmatov, Jasur Ashiralievich Mirzaev

Bulletin of Gulistan State University

In irrigated lands of the Aral Sea Basin, salt-affected areas are increasingly rising and this negatively impacts agricultural development and food security in such countries located in the basin. Drivers, increasing salt-affected areas, are assumed to be climate change, unregulated high groundwater levels and its increased mineralization, poor functioning of the collector-drainage system, and insufficient compliance with agro-technical requirements. These drivers, in turn, lead to the withdrawal of arable land from agricultural purposes and a significant drop in crop yields.
